Job Summary /Basic Function
We are seeking a detail-oriented and reliable Test Proctor to ensure the smooth administration of examinations and assessments. Testing Proctors are responsible for maintaining the integrity of the testing environment, ensuring adherence to established testing protocols, and providing excellent customer care to candidates. This role demands a high level of professionalism, effective communication skills, and a strong commitment to upholding academic and procedural integrity.
